Atmel opstarten 5: Levenslijn (1 / 13 stap)

Stap 1: Bouw van de behuizing van de levenslijn


Figuur 2: Kunststof retainer (aan de rechterkant) en de onderste achterste contactpersoon zijn verwijderd. De schakelaar kan worden gehecht aan de houder op de rechterbovenhoek gezien. Figuur 3: Het voorjaar werd getrokken op het elektrisch contact en het contact werd vervolgens ingediend om het oppervlak ruw, en ten slotte werd een draad gesoldeerd aan de contactpersoon. De contactpersoon kan dan door het recht naar beneden in de sleuven in de plastic houder worden vervangen. Figuur 4: De originele rode draad zit soldeerder IC Pin 12 (rechtsonder). Ene uiteinde van een draad is vastgesoldeerd aan de onderste links contact en het andere uiteinde op de MCU PIN-code 20. Een andere draad heeft een einde vastgesoldeerd aan IC-Pin 10 en het andere uiteinde op een terminal op de switch (die heeft ook een zwarte draad). Merk op dat Pin 1 in de buurt van een kleine inkeping aan het einde van de aansluiting is. Figuur 1B: Herhaling van afgewerkte geval voor vergelijking.

De behuizing van de levenslijn wijzigt een geschakelde batterijhouder kunnen houden vier AA-batterijen. De wijzigingen en aanvullingen op de behuizing zijn relatief ongecompliceerd en gemakkelijk. Het prototype beschreven gebruikt hier drie AA batterijen die spanningen tot ongeveer 4,9 volt kunnen produceren. De levenslijn moet als zodanig alleen worden gebruikt met doel MCU's uitgevoerd uit 5V. Stap 2 en 3 hieronder alternatieven bieden voor deze doelgroep MCU's op 3,3 volt, maar voor de levenslijn Mark 1, die we graag het toevoegen van een weerstand van de serie 1000 Ohm of een batterij vervangen door een kortsluiting schroef ter dekking van verschillende mogelijke scenario's. De volgende stappen bieden de wijzigingen in de behuizing:

  1. De eerste stap voor de bouw van de levenslijn bestaat uit de behuizing openen en zachtjes nieuwsgierige omhoog de kunststof vazal boven de switch starten aan het ene uiteinde in plaats van in het midden (figuur 2). Echter beschadigen de vazal niet leiden tot veel probleem omdat het niet veel sterkte toe te aan het vak voegen.

  2. De metalen contact met de rode draad van de plastic behuizing met behulp van wees-neus buigtang uitlichten – het contact trekt recht omhoog. Illustraties uit de rode draad in het contact, maar laat die deze door het rechter gat in de plastic behuizing geplaatst. De rode draad zal worden aangesloten op de MCU pin 12 voor het uitgangssignaal. Aankondiging pin 12 verwijst naar de 20pin duik pakket voor de ATTiny2313A. Zie figuur 2.

  3. Verwijder de contactpersoon instellen die het verst van de schakeloptie met behulp van wees-neus buigtang-het recht omhoog trekt. Zie figuur 2. Trekken uit het voorjaar. Gebruik een boete van bestand naar bestand/Rough van het gedeelte van de contactpersoon waar de lente was gekoppeld. Met behulp van een derde hand te houden van het metaal, soldeer warmte het metaal met een soldeerbout en stroom totdat het gat is gevuld. Zie figuur 3.

  4. Soldeer dunne 24ga koperen draad (stranded is beter maar solid werkt) aan de contactpersoon op zodanige wijze dat de draad aan de binnenkant van de behuizing zullen als de contactpersoon vervangen (Fig. 4) in plaats van bevindt zich tussen het metaal en het plastic. De draad is rood om aan te geven dat het de positieve verbinding met de batterij zal zijn. Soldeer het andere uiteinde op de pin 20 op de dip socket. Vervang de contactpersoon in een socket. Figuur 4 toont de batterijen en de MCU in een socket, die heeft gebracht ondersteboven in de batterijhouder zodat de pinnen zichtbaar zijn.

  5. De IC-socket al is verbonden met de positieve accu contact. We moeten de batterij negatief aan de IC-socket, maar via de switch verbinding maken. Merken dat de schakelaar een zwarte draad gesoldeerd aan één terminal heeft en de contactpersoon van de negatieve batterij zit soldeerder rechtstreeks naar de middelste schakelaar terminal. Dus, soldeer een 24ga draad (stranded is beter maar solid zal werken ok) naar de zwart leiden op de switch en het andere uiteinde aan op pin 10 soldeer zoals afgebeeld in figuur 4. De leiding van de zwarte verlaten van de plastic u zal de grond van de logica en het zal worden aangesloten op de grond van de logica van het externe circuit. De schakeloptie Hiermee verbreekt u de verbinding van de grond voor de accu en niet de positieve verbinding zoals gebruikelijk is voor vele circuits.

  6. De rode draad die eerder met de metalen contactpersoon bij punt 2 hierboven verbonden was, kan nu worden bevestigd. Soldeer het einde van de rode draad naar pin 12 op de dip socket. Wikkel de rode draad rond de kunststof post voor een beetje extra steun en sturen de taak door het geval gat.

  7. Duw de pinnen van de duik naar beneden om ervoor te zorgen dat zij niet korte. Als u niet vooruitlopen op het toevoegen van meer functie (en vandaar draden), kunt u sommige snelle droging epoxy om de pinnen. Installeer niet de MCU zoals dat dient te worden geprogrammeerd met behulp van de experimentator bestuur.

  8. Vervang de kunststof vazal en u klaar bent met deze sectie, tenzij u van plan bent te gebruiken levenslijn met 3.3V Atmel MCUs in welk geval Lees verder.

Als u verwacht dat werken met AVR's bevooroordeeld op 3,3 v, moeten enkele wijzigingen worden aangebracht omdat de levenslijn met de drie batterijen het doel AVR's beschadigen. De Atmel MCUs heb. dioden aangesloten op de pinnen (opstarten 4) die kunnen helpen bij het beschermen van het MCU maar deze dioden kan alleen handvat over 1mA Er zijn verschillende oplossingen mogelijk: (1) een van de batterijen te verwijderen en de ruimte contacten voor de verwijderde cel korte. (2) Voeg een 1000 Ohm weerstand in serie met de uitgang-draad (rood) van pin 12. (3) een schakelaar of andere componenten toevoegen. We implementeren opties 1 en 2 zonodig-beide zijn getest en werken OK. In feite, kan het drie-batterij-Lineline met de serie weerstand veilig dichtgemetseld AVR's gebouwd op de experimentator breadboard en draait op of 3.3V als 5V herprogrammeren. Het lijkt misschien een goed idee om de weerstand in het terrarium permanent toevoegen aangezien het zal werken met beide spanningen, maar dat weerstand vermindert tevens het huidige station naar de pinnen van de gerichte dichtgemetseld MCU, vooral wanneer andere onderdelen kunnen worden aangesloten op deze pinnen.

Gerelateerde Artikelen

Atmel opstarten 4: BLINKIE twee-Switches, Pull-Up weerstanden en bits Ops

Atmel opstarten 4: BLINKIE twee-Switches, Pull-Up weerstanden en bits Ops

Figuur 1: Voorbeeld schakelopties waarmee kunnen de MCU pull-up resisters, Front: foto-weerstand, foto-transistor, drukknop; Achterzijde: voorbeeld van de cijfertoetsen.M. A. Parker c2015Blinky twee toont aan hoe de MCU gemakkelijk kan lezen van de s
Atmel opstarten 1: Atmel Studio en programmeur

Atmel opstarten 1: Atmel Studio en programmeur

M. A. Parker c2015Installeren Atmel Studio (AS) en een programmeur belichamen de eerste stappen [0] op het pad aan het gebruik van een afzonderlijke eenheid voor Atmel AVR Microcontroller MCU [1] in tegenstelling tot de MCU-on-a-board zoals Arduino [
Atmel opstarten 2: Microcontroller-schakelingen en zekeringen

Atmel opstarten 2: Microcontroller-schakelingen en zekeringen

M. A. Parker c2015Circuits en zekeringen construeert een eenvoudige maar belangrijke circuit op de experimentator breadboard die zal worden gebruikt als het fundamentele platform voor vele microcontroller projecten en voor het instellen van de parame
Atmel opstarten 3: Binky een-poort, PIN, DDR en LED

Atmel opstarten 3: Binky een-poort, PIN, DDR en LED

M. A. Parker c2015Blinky, de knipperende LED, laat zien hoe met de taal C/C++ in Atmel Studio (AS) om te controleren de Atmel MCU poorten voor input en output (dat wil zeggen, IO) en het 'geheim' leven van de Atmel poort, PIN en DDR registers blijkt.
Het op afstand opstarten van pcDuino van een NFS-server

Het op afstand opstarten van pcDuino van een NFS-server

Gevallen willen wij pcDuino te starten vanaf een netwerk gehost bestandsysteem. In deze tutorial zullen we uitleggen hoe dit waar te maken.Stap 1: NFS serverWij zullen eerst een NFS server instellen. Het volgende commando zal worden gebruikt op een X
Het wijzigen van opstarten programma's Windows 7

Het wijzigen van opstarten programma's Windows 7

Wij leggen uit hoe te veranderen van ongewenste programma's uit de map Opstarten in Windows 7.Stap 1:Wanneer u Windows 7 gebruikt, voert dit besturingssysteem automatisch bepaalde programma's elke keer dat u de computer opstart. Volg deze video als u
MAME arcade kast opstarten (instructies als je wilt aanvragen:))

MAME arcade kast opstarten (instructies als je wilt aanvragen:))

He jongens! Dit is slechts een korte video van het opstarten van mijn Mame arcade machine. Helaas maken ik niet een volledige instructable... (er was veel trial and error) maar als je afvraagt hoe ik het deed iets ik meer dan bereid ben om een stap v
Naam op 7-segment Display Atmel Avr

Naam op 7-segment Display Atmel Avr

In dit instructable (mijn eerste one!) Ik wil je laten zien iets wat die ik voor een schoolproject gemaakt. De oorspronkelijke opdracht was als volgt: "In MSVS (of Microsoft visual studio) code in assembler: invoeren van uw naam als een ASCII-hexadec
Atmel Xmega USB/serieel willekeurige golfvorm Generator

Atmel Xmega USB/serieel willekeurige golfvorm Generator

dit instructable loopt u via programmering en de Boston Android Xmega evaluatie board gebruiken om te werken als een eenvoudige willekeurige golfvorm generator te profiteren van de geïntegreerde 12 bit DAC en hoge snelheid DMA-controller. Ik heb voor
Arduino op allerlei Atmels

Arduino op allerlei Atmels

Hallo,Dit is mijn eerste instructable, dus ik hoop dat iemand iets goeds mee kunt doen.Dus, wat is dit over?Stel: U werkt aan een project. U wenst te programmeren in de taal van de Arduino vanwege de simplicy. Maar u niet wilt gebruiken van een monst
Opstarten iemand off line met behulp van CMD.

Opstarten iemand off line met behulp van CMD.

Vandaag de dag. Ik zal je leren hoe om te booten iemand offline!Wat je nodig hebt:1. goede internetverbinding2. CMD (zijn op elke pc)3. doelgroep met slecht internet4. IP-* DONT BOOT GROTE WEBSITES OF DIENSTEN ZOALS GOOGLE. ALLEEN DOEN VRIENDEN *Stap
Raspberry Pi: Lancering Python script bij het opstarten

Raspberry Pi: Lancering Python script bij het opstarten

als ik aan mijn eigen projecten Pi gewerkt heb, ik heb is het ontdekken van vele kleine trucs en tips door wassen van diverse websites en informatie assembleren, testen en optimaliseren.Dus, hier is nog een van mijn "meat-and-potatoes" Raspberry
Afsluiten, opnieuw opstarten, of slaapstand van de computer op een schema

Afsluiten, opnieuw opstarten, of slaapstand van de computer op een schema

In dit instructable, ik zal tonen u hoe te afsluiten, opnieuw opstarten, of slaapstand van de computer op een schema.Zie de mededeling aan het eind als u een ouder besturingssysteem dan Windows XP gebruikt.Stap 1: Maak een batch-bestand Eerste, moet
Hoe te stoppen met Windows Live Messenger opduiken bij het opstarten.

Hoe te stoppen met Windows Live Messenger opduiken bij het opstarten.

ik heb geërgerd onlangs met mijn Windows Live Messenger opduiken bij het opstarten, want ik wil niet elke keer krijg ik op mijn laptop inloggen... Dus, ik vond een manier op hoe deze actie in-/ uitschakelen, en ik dacht dat ik zou delen met de Gemeen